Though we didn't find scientific evidence to back the claim, experts say ceramic curling irons like the Infiniti by Conair Tourmaline Ceramic Curling Iron cause less damage than those with plain metal barrels. Users seem to notice a difference as well, and say that for the price, you can't go wrong with Conair. The curling iron boasts some nice convenience features, such as variable temperature control, automatic shut-off and an LED temperature display. Reviewers say it heats up quickly and produces long-lasting curls. Several, however, complain that the power switch is poorly located and can be turned off inadvertently while curling hair. The Infiniti by Conair Tourmaline Ceramic Curling Iron has a 9-foot cord. If you prefer a curling iron that stays on all the time, we read good reviews for the Hot Tools Professional Curling Iron (*Est. $26).

We found the most reliable reviews of the Infiniti by Conair Tourmaline Ceramic Curling Iron at user review sites such as Amazon.com and MakeupAlley.com, where several users award it high ratings for reliability.

Our Sources

1. Amazon.com

The Infiniti by Conair Tourmaline Ceramic Curling Iron gets an above-average rating at Amazon.com from several users. It's highly rated for its fast heat-up time and for producing long-lasting curls. Some complain, however, that the grip tip is not long enough, making it easy to burn your fingertips.

Review: Conair Infiniti Professional Tourmaline Ceramic Curling Iron, Contributors to Amazon.com

2. MakeupAlley.com

Consumers at MakeupAlley.com praise the Infiniti by Conair Tourmaline Ceramic Curling Iron for long-lasting curls and an affordable price tag. Several complain, however, that the power switch is poorly located.
